biggie
/ˈbɪɡi/Definitions
1. noun
A term used to refer to a large or impressive amount of something, especially money, or a person of significant importance or influence.
“He was a biggie in the music industry, known for his chart-topping hits.”
2. noun
A variant of ‘biggie’, referring to Christopher Wallace, a well-known American rapper also known as The Notorious B.I.G.
“The rapper’s death was a tragic loss to the music world and his fans, who affectionately called him the Biggie.”
